This file is used to store intervention types.  Intervention types are actually reasons that a pharmacist had to stop filling a
prescription and contact a provider to either change the prescription or get clarification of it.  Examples of intervention types
may include things such as: CRITICAL DRUG INTERACTION, ALLERGY, INCORRECT DOSE, etc.  



   APPLICATION GROUP(S): PSO

POINTED TO BY: INTERVENTION field (#.07) of the APSP INTERVENTION File (#9009032.4)
